There are just some things that the Fixture Builder does not accomplish. I find that manual editing in an IDE or text editor will clean up the untidy bits...or a dedicated .XML editor will work as well.
I do notice a difference in the amount of data the fixture Builder saves files from the files that are saved from within the console/desk itself...your mileage may vary.
I prefer an IDE for editing; you can collapse and expand the dataBlocks instead of trying to read a wall of text, ;). The console is best but the GUI system of a single window and paging through things is tedious. Having all the sections exposed, as in the fixtureBuilder, is not tedious-but lacking in some ways as I mentioned.
